Donc101 Posted September 10, 2018 Posted September 10, 2018 (edited) Michigan Steel Bending and Breaking Championship · Date: May 4, 2019 · Venue: Birmingham, MI · $35 entry fee · Message Don Cummings (Donc101) if you are interested in coming · Strongman scoring will be used for all events · There will be recognition for 1st through 3rd for: Steel Bending and Breaking Champion (all events scoring considered), Unbraced Bending Champion (events 1-3 combined), Braced Bending and Snapping Champion (events 4-6 combined) and Medley Winner · Prizes: Josh Henze, Jedd Johnson/ Diesel Crew and Camp Verde Rope and Gear are sponsoring the event and have sent prizes. I made trophies for 1st, 2nd and 3rd overall. The bending medley is the signature event for the contest and the winner of the medley will get a separate trophy. I am cooking up a bunch of food. After the contest, we will have tons to eat and drink and have a blast to celebrate a wonderful day of bending! Events Unbraced Steel Bending 1. Double Overhand Bending: · 1:00 time limit. 2 attempts. · Iron Mind pads. · Bar bent to within 2 inches. · Hardest bar bent wins. Faster bend of same bar wins. · Bars available: All bars 7" length. All steel from FBBC: 1/4", 9/32", 1/4" square, 5/16", 11/32" and 3/8" 2. Reverse Bending: · DHWOG steel and rules. 1 attempt. · We will use Grade 8 bolts, Grade 5 bolts, blue nails and weaker steel if necessary. · Here are the rules from their page (http://www.davidhorne-gripmaster.com/bhsarules.html): · Time limit = 30 seconds · Partial bends score and beat a full bend of a weaker bar. · A bend is finished when you attain a 40 degree plus angle of bend. · Wraps for protection will be the World of Grip 10" x 4" suede wrap on each side of the bar, touching in the middle. The current World Records are here: http://www.davidhorne-gripmaster.com/worldrecords.html#bending 3. Double Underhand Bending: · 1:00 time limit. 2 attempts. · Iron Mind pads. · Bar bent to 40 degrees to be completed. · Partial bends score and beat a full bend of a weaker bar. · Hardest bar bent wins. Faster bend of same bar wins. · Bars available: All bars 7" length. All steel from FBBC: 1/4", 9/32", 1/4" square, 5/16", 11/32" and 3/8" Braced Steel Bending and Snapping 1. Long Bar Bending · 5:00 time limit. · Double wraps allowed. · Towel for knee/leg. · A completed bend is when the bar has been bent into a "u" shape and the legs are parallel to each other. · 1 attempt. · Thicker bar beats thinner, bend of shorter bar at same diameter beats longer bar, faster bend of same diameter and length wins. · A partial bend beats a completed bend of an easier bar. If multiple partial bends on the same bar, the bar bent the furthest wins. · Steel: A36 Hot Rolled Round. · Bars available: ¾ x 40”, ¾ x 44”, ¾ x 48”, 5/8 x 32”, 5/8 x 36” 2. Spike Bar Bending · 5:00 time limit. · Single DHWOG wraps will be used. · Towel for knee/leg. · A completed bend is when the bar has been bent into a "u" shape and the legs are parallel to each other. · 1 attempt. · Harder bar wins. Faster bend of same bar wins. · Bars available: 3/8" spikes from Lowes. 8", 10" and 12". The 8" are mutants and unlikely to be bent in single wraps. 3. Bending and Snapping Medley The medley will include: · Crescent Wrench Bend (10" wrench: 4 points, 8" wrench: 3 points, 6" wrench: 2 points) · Horseshoe Bend: Diamond Bronco PL 000: 4 points, Diamond Classic 1: 3 points, SCF Ultralite: 2 points · Unbraced Steel Snap (DHWOG oval nails. 1 point per snap. 4 points max) · Braced Steel Snap (HRS: 3/8" x 14" = 4 points. 5/16" x 12" = 2 points) You pick which bend from each category that you want to do. You have 20 minutes to complete all bends. The most points wins. If there are ties, fastest time with the same number of points wins. Most likely we will have multiple people going at once. Don, I’m not sure I grok the rule for reverse bending: “The object being bent should be kept between an imaginary line from the groin to the head and not go above or below this.” Can you dumb it down a shade? It’s nothing complex. While bending your just supposed to keep your hands above your waist and below your head. Quote
